mmultiassay_ov          Example data for a standard workflow. This is
                        an example dataset containing a
                        MultiAssayExperiment of 20 ovarian cancer (OVC)
                        patients extracted from the Cancer Genome Atlas
                        (TCGA) database. The object contains all the
                        available input data types: Gene expression
                        data, miRNA expression data, gene methylation
                        data, gene Copy Number Variations and miRNA
                        Copy Number Variations.
